On 07/11/10 08:31 PM, Glyn Webster wrote:
> I have a 2GB RAM chip in my Asus 701 4G, and I am getting an error very
> like this one when I use Memtest-86:
> 
>     http://bugs.debian.org/cgi-bin/bugreport.cgi?bug=522525
> 
> The RAM chip is the cheapest I could find though, not an ECC one. The
> same thing happens on a friend's 701 4G.
> 
> Memtest86+ 4.10 (from the 'memtest+' package) reports no errors at all,
> and my laptop is working fine, so I assume there's some sort of bug in
> Memtest-86 when used on a 701 4G.
> 
> Should I report this as a bug in Memtest-86? Or does it belong here?
> 
> (I just about threw my netbook out because of this, I'm so glad I
> decided to double-check at the last moment! %-| )

If you have reason to believe it's the same bug as #522525, just submit
any further info you think may help on that bug report without opening a
new one.
